Presenting 43 Inglis Classic yearlings at the Riverside complex for the 2021 sale, Arrowfield has delivered recent Group 1 success by Classic graduates including Group 1 winner Maid Of Heaven, dual Group 1 winner Castelvecchio and Group 1-placed Hit The Shot.

Other Classic stakes performers carrying the Arrowfield brand include: Spill The Beans, Odyssey Moon, Untamed Diamond, Dealmaker, Game Of Thorns, Perfect Match and Atonement.

The online catalogue includes relevant pedigree research, videos, and extensive information about each yearling, with the ability to view our entire draft in an easy online location.
